Acquired in 2017, Payfort was part of the Souq Group acquisition, and now Amazon has completed integrating Payfort into the Amazon UAE ecosystem. Amazon Payment Services provides access to a range of payment services to its business customers. This enables them to accept online payments using both global and local payment methods, offer instalments to customers, and monitor payment performance round the clock.
New services offered by Amazon Payment Services provide reports with insights and real-time monitoring of payment activities. In addition, businesses can get transaction authentication and reduce friction at checkout. Businesses can also build their dashboard by merging their data from different sources which helps them track and meet their goals.
Amazon Payment Services processes transactions across multiple industries, ranging from aviation to travel and tourism, retail, insurance, real estate, government, and more. Partner banks include Rak Bank, First Abu Dhabi Bank (FAB), Mashreq, the Saudi British Bank (SABB), Al Rajhi Bank, Riyad Bank, and National Commercial Bank (NCB), as well as local card schemes such as MADA and Meeza, and international card services such as Visa and MasterCard.
